20140020851 | INSULATED GLASS BLIND ASSEMBLY - An insulated glass assembly providing a simple and effective construction for installing a modular assembly inside the insulated glass assembly. The insulated glass assembly may include a spacer frame configured to support the modular assembly, such as a modular blind or shade assembly. The modular assembly may include a head rail module and a control operator module that may be captured by the spacer frame. For example, the spacer frame may capture the head rail module near the upper portion or the lower portion of the insulated glass blind assembly, and may capture the control operator module on a side adjacent to the head rail module. | 01-23-2014 |

20130032498 | PACKAGING FOR BEVERAGE CONTAINERS OF DIFFERENT SIZES - Universal packaging for beverage containers of different sizes is described. The universal packaging includes a bottom support structure including an opening having an interior floor surface. A raised cylinder extends upwards from the interior floor surface. A beverage container of a first height fits within the opening in the bottom support by placing an open side of the beverage container down upon the interior floor surface, the raised cylinder extending into an interior of the beverage container of the first height. A beverage container of a second height, the second height being less than the first height, fits within the opening in the bottom support by placing a solid bottom surface of the beverage container of the second height down upon an upper surface of the raised cylinder. | 02-07-2013 |

20140105507 | AUTOMATIC EVALUATION OF LINE WEIGHTS - Systems and methods may automatically evaluate printed line weights in an image composition. An image composition may be received and the number of horizontal and vertical rows of pixels may be determined. The number of positive pixels in each of the horizontal and vertical rows may then be determined. An actual size of a pixel may be calculated. The actual size of a pixel may be multiplied by the number of positive pixels in each of the horizontal rows and each of the vertical rows to determine a positive line weight of each of the horizontal rows and each of the vertical rows. A predetermined minimum permissible positive line weight for the image composition may be identified and compared to the positive line weight of each of the horizontal rows and each of the vertical rows. | 04-17-2014 |

20090249210 | COMPUTER SYSTEM WITH ENHANCED USER INTERFACE FOR IMAGES - A computer system and method are presented that enhance a user experience when viewing images displayed on the computer. The system includes a user interface for the computer that displays a number of thumbnail images that are small representations of image files existing on the computer. The thumbnail images are arranged in alignment with one another, such as at the bottom of a viewing window. An enlarged preview image is positioned adjacent the thumbnail images. The enlarged preview image corresponds to a selected thumbnail image and is a larger representation of an image file corresponding with the selected thumbnail image. A control is displayed in the window that enables the user to iterate through the thumbnail images in at least one direction. As the user iterates through the thumbnail images, the enlarged preview image changes correspondingly. | 10-01-2009 |

20120196580 | METHODS AND APPARATUSES FOR TACTILE CALLER IDENTIFICATION IN HEARING-IMPAIRED COMMUNICATION SYSTEMS - Methods and apparatuses for indicating an incoming call on a portable communication device are disclosed. A calling connection indicator is captured from an incoming call. An identified entry is selected from a caller identification list comprising one or more entries, wherein each of the entries is associated with a contact of a user of the portable communication device and includes one or more connection indicators for the contact and a tactile pattern for the contact. The identified entry is selected by matching the calling connection indicator to one of the one or more connection indicators. A tactile pattern is generated for the portable communication device. The tactile pattern includes a predefined tactile pattern associated with the identified entry in the caller identification list or a default tactile pattern if the calling connection indicator does not correlate to any of the connection indicators in the caller identification list. | 08-02-2012 |

20150310635 | SPECULAR HIGHLIGHTS ON PHOTOS OF OBJECTS - Systems and methods are presented for recording and viewing images of objects with specular highlights. In some embodiments, a computer-implemented method may include accessing a first plurality of images, each of the images in the first plurality of images including an object recorded from a first position, and a reflection of light on the object from a light source located at a different location than in each of the other images in the first plurality of images. The method may also include generating a first composite image of the object, the first composite image comprising a superposition of the first plurality of images, and wherein each of the images in the first plurality of images is configured to change in a degree of transparency within the first composite image and in accordance with a first input based on a degree of tilt. | 10-29-2015 |
